When I travel from an area that has 4G into an area that has 5G or vice versa the audio on my phone will sound like Donald Duck and on calls, I am unable to hear the person on the other end.
There is a work around for this issue, removing the sim card and replacing it. However, before I figured this out I got stranded at SFO at midnight unable to use my phone.
